WASHINGTON (AP) — In a busy term that could set standards for free speech in the digital age, the Supreme Court on Monday is taking up a dispute between Republican-led states and the Biden administration over how far the federal government can go to combat controversial social media posts on topics including COVID-19 and election security.
The justices are hearing arguments in a lawsuit filed by Louisiana, Missouri and other parties accusing officials in the Democratic administration of leaning on the social media platforms to unconstitutionally squelch conservative points of view. Lower courts have sided with the states, but the Supreme Court blocked those rulings while it considers the issue.
The high court is in the midst of a term heavy with social media issues. On Friday, the court laid out standards for when public officials can block their social media followers. Less than a month ago, the court heard arguments over Republican-passed laws in Florida and Texas that prohibit large social media companies from taking down posts because of the views they express.
The cases over state laws and the one being argued Monday are variations on the same theme, complaints that the platforms are censoring conservative viewpoints.
The states argue that White House communications staffers, the surgeon general, the FBI and the U.S. cybersecurity agency are among those who coerced changes in online content on Facebook, X (formerly Twitter) and other media platforms.
“It’s a very, very threatening thing when the federal government uses the power and authority of the government to block people from exercising their freedom of speech,” Louisiana Attorney General Liz Murrill said in a video her office posted online.
The administration responds that none of the actions the states complain about come close to problematic coercion. The states “still have not identified any instance in which any government official sought to coerce a platform’s editorial decisions with a threat of adverse government action,” wrote Solicitor General Elizabeth Prelogar, the administration's top Supreme Court lawyer. Prelogar wrote that states also can't “point to any evidence that the government ever imposed any sanction when the platforms declined to moderate content the government had flagged — as routinely occurred.”
The companies themselves are not involved in the case.
Free speech advocates say the court should use the case to draw an appropriate line between the government's acceptable use of the bully pulpit and coercive threats to free speech.
"The government has no authority to threaten platforms into censoring protected speech, but it must have the ability to participate in public discourse so that it can effectively govern and inform the public of its views,” Alex Abdo, litigation director of the Knight First Amendment Institute at Columbia University, said in a statement.
A panel of three judges on the New Orleans-based 5th U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als had ruled earlier that the Biden administration had probably brought unconstitutional pressure on the media platforms. The appellate panel said officials cannot attempt to “coerce or significantly encourage” changes in online content. The panel had previously narrowed a more sweeping order from a federal judge, who wanted to include even more government officials and prohibit mere encouragement of content changes.
A divided Supreme Court put the 5th Circuit ruling on hold in October, when it agreed to take up the case.
Justices Samuel Alito, Neil Gorsuch and Clarence Thomas would have rejected the emergency appeal from the Biden administration.
Alito wrote in dissent in October: “At this time in the history of our country, what the Court has done, I fear, will be seen by some as giving the Government a green light to use heavy-handed tactics to skew the presentation of views on the medium that increasingly dominates the dissemination of news. That is most unfortunate."
A decision in Murthy v. Missouri, 23-411, is expected by early summer.

The US Supreme Court seems torn over whether to trigger a radical transformation of the internet. The nation’s highest court heard arguments Monday over state laws in Florida and Texas that restrict how platforms like Facebook and YouTube moderate speech. If the court lets them take effect, social media feeds could look very different, with platforms forced to carry unsavory or hateful content that today is blocked or removed.
The high stakes gave long-standing questions about free speech and online regulation new urgency in Monday’s arguments. Are social platforms akin to newspapers, which have First Amendment protections that give them editorial control over content—or are they common carriers, like phone providers or telegraph companies, that are required to transmit protected speech without interference?
A ruling is expected by June, when the court typically issues many decisions, and could have sweeping effects on how social sites like Facebook, YouTube, X, and TikTok do business beyond Florida and Texas. “These cases could shape free speech online for a generation,” says Alex Abdo, litigation director of the Knight First Amendment Institute at Columbia University, which filed a brief in the case but did not take sides.
Florida and Texas passed the laws under debate in 2021, not long after social media platforms booted former president Donald Trump following the January 6 insurrection. Conservatives had long argued that their viewpoints were unfairly censored on major platforms. Laws barring companies from strict moderation were pitched as a way to restore fairness online.
The laws were quickly put on hold after two tech-industry trade associations representing social platforms, NetChoice and the Computer & Communications Industry Association, challenged them. If the Supreme Court now allows the laws to stand, state governments in Florida and Texas would gain new power to control social platforms and the content posted on them, a major shift from the situation today where platforms set their own terms of service and generally hire moderators to police content.
Polar Opposites
Monday’s arguments, spanning nearly four hours, underscored the legal confusion inherent to regulating the internet that remains. Justices raised questions about how social media companies should be categorized and treated under the law, and the states and plaintiffs provided opposing views of social media’s role in mass communication.
The laws themselves leave gaps as to how exactly their mandates would be enforced. The questions posed by the justices showed the court’s frustration at being “caught between two polar opposite positions, both of which have significant costs and benefits for freedom of speech,” says Cliff Davidson, a Portland-based attorney at Snell & Wilmer.
David Greene, senior staff attorney and civil liberties director at the digital rights group Electronic Frontier Foundation, which filed a brief urging the court to strike down the laws, says there are clear public benefits to allowing social platforms to moderate content without government interference. “When platforms have First Amendment rights to curate the user-generated content they publish, they can create distinct forums that accommodate diverse viewpoints, interests, and beliefs,” he says.
Greene argues that the laws raise “significant First Amendment and human rights concerns” and are “profound intrusions into social media sites’ ability to decide for themselves what speech they will publish and how they will present it to users.”
Florida’s law prevents social media companies from permanently banning candidates for office or “journalistic enterprises” from their platforms, even when they post content typically barred by a platform. Texas’ law says companies cannot moderate content based on the viewpoints it expresses—potentially neutering many moderation policies such as against hate speech. Lower courts have been split on the rules: Florida’s law was deemed unconstitutional by a federal appeals court, but Texas’ was upheld by a different appeals court.
Florida’s law is worded broadly, and justices wondered Monday whether it could cover platforms like Uber, Etsy, and Gmail, which carry out far different purposes than social media services like Facebook, YouTube, and TikTok. The Texas law is more narrow and applies only to social media companies with 50 million active monthly users.
The trade associations argue that social platforms are like newspapers and should be protected to publish content without government interference. But the states argued that now that social media companies have become public squares of the 21st century, they act more like telephone networks carrying messages between people and should be required to be neutral.
In the US, social media companies have long been protected by Section 230 of the Communications Decency Act from liability for content they host. The state laws, which would impose penalties for moderating content, would create new liabilities for companies, compromising the long-standing immunity provided by Section 230.
Tricky Decision
Some argue the fate of the two laws will have consequences that reach far beyond social platform moderation. If the court upholds injunctions on the Texas law, it could set a precedent that stifles the ability of Congress or state governments to write better laws to regulate social platforms, a group of liberal law professors argue in a brief filed in support of Texas in the case.
“Rather than lining up to give Meta, YouTube, X, and TikTok capacious constitutional immunity, the people who are worried about these laws should be focusing their energies on getting Congress to pass more sensible regulations instead,” Zephyr Teachout, a professor at Fordham Law School who joined the brief, wrote in The Atlantic.
The justices expressed skepticism around the laws during the arguments and “seemed to recognize that it would be unconstitutional to hand to the government the unfettered power to dictate what can be said on private platforms,” Abdo, of the Knight Institute, says. “We’re hopeful that the court will strike down the must-carry provisions but chart a path forward for reasonable social media transparency laws.”
Lasting solutions to long-running debates over how to regulate online speech will require more than a single court decision.

On Friday May 20th I went for a CT scan and then saw my oncologist. She had hoped that radiology would give her a rapid reading but they were swamped & said that not only would they not get it done by end of Friday, but also since it’s a long weekend, they weren’t sure they’d have it by Tuesday. 
So, we wait.  
For what it’s worth, I think I have progression. Between some wonky liver function blood values and some occasional abdo pain, my suspicion is that the liver mets are growing. But it’s a guess.
We did spend some time talking about our next options - there are several chemos, there’s no way to know if they will work or not (based on the studies, statistically they all have poor outcomes. Like so poor that it’s mind boggling that this is what we have. Research, people! We need you to make actual working drugs for us!!) & they all have various side effect profiles. At one point, once she had gone through two chemos, I mentioned a third one I was thinking about & she said, yup, that’s a reasonable option too. It’s a random crapshoot. You take it, try it for 12 weeks, scan & see if anything responded (& hope in the meantime that your cancer doesn’t trigger organ failure) 
One of the options is an oral chemo, which some people manage to tolerate well but a fair number suffer extreme damage to the skin on their feet and hands caused by this chemo. And again, it works for a few people, doesn’t work for most. 
The IV chemos are all pretty much what you’d expect - nausea, fatigue, slamming your bone marrow resulting in low blood counts etc etc. And the bigger issue with IV chemos right now at my cancer center is that they’re so swamped they have a WAIT LIST!
So anyway, we wait for the CT scan results because we can’t decide one way or the other until then.
